
Leuven, Belgium, March 1, 2013
Bioversity International has signed an agreement with the Katholieke Universiteit Leuven (KU Leuven) to support the world’s collection of banana and plantain germplasm. Per the agreement signed today, Bioversity will host its Musa germplasm collection at the new premises of KU Leuven, which will maintain the facilities to be called the Bioversity Musa Germplasm Transit Centre.
